Understanding Warranty Coverage for Automated Manual Transmission Actuator Components
Warranty coverage for automated manual transmission actuator components typically defines the extent and duration of protection offered by manufacturers. It generally includes repairs or replacements for defects arising from manufacturing, materials, or workmanship within a specified warranty period. Understanding this coverage is essential for both manufacturers and consumers.
Warranty terms often specify conditions such as proper installation, authorized use, and routine maintenance to ensure coverage remains valid. They may exclude coverage for damage caused by misuse, accidents, or unauthorized repairs, emphasizing the importance of adherence to manufacturer guidelines.
Additionally, warranty periods vary based on the component type and manufacturer’s policies. Some may offer limited warranties covering only certain parts or failures, while others provide more comprehensive coverage. Clarifying these terms helps manage expectations and reduces potential disputes related to warranty and liability issues with actuator components.

Implications of Installation Errors on Warranty and Liability
Installation errors can significantly impact warranty coverage and liability in automated manual transmission actuators. Improper installation, such as incorrect torque application or misalignment, often leads to premature component failure, which may void warranty claims. Manufacturers typically specify that warranty coverage excludes damages caused by installation mistakes.
Liability issues also arise when installation errors directly contribute to actuator failure. If a technician’s mistake is identified as the cause, the manufacturer may deny warranty claims and seek repair costs from the service provider. This shifts financial responsibility away from the manufacturer and underscores the importance of proper installation practices.
To mitigate these implications, it is essential for technicians and installers to adhere strictly to manufacturer guidelines and ensure accurate installation procedures. Proper training and audit protocols can reduce the risk of errors, thereby safeguarding warranty validity and limiting liability exposure.
